What is XCShellMenu.x86.dll?

A DLL (Dynamic Link Library) file is like a shared recipe book for computer programs. Specifically, XCShellMenu.x86.dll is a type of DLL file that helps computer programs work together smoothly. It contains code and data that multiple programs can use at the same time, which makes the computer run more efficiently.

In the case of PDF-XChange Editor, XCShellMenu.x86.dll plays a critical role. It provides important functions related to the software's menu system, allowing it to integrate seamlessly with the Windows operating system. Without XCShellMenu.x86.dll, PDF-XChange Editor may not be able to display menus or context menus correctly, affecting the overall user experience and functionality of the software.

Therefore, XCShellMenu.x86.dll is crucial for the proper functioning of PDF-XChange Editor on a Windows-based system.

Although essential for system performance, dynamic Link Library (DLL) files can occasionally cause specific errors. The following enumerates some of the most common DLL errors users encounter while operating their systems:

  • XCShellMenu.x86.dll Access Violation: This points to a situation where a process has attempted to interact with XCShellMenu.x86.dll in a way that violates system or application rules. This might be due to incorrect programming, memory overflows, or the running process lacking necessary permissions.
  • This application failed to start because XCShellMenu.x86.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error occurs when an application tries to access a DLL file that doesn't exist in the system. Reinstalling the application can restore the missing DLL file if it was included in the original software package.
  • XCShellMenu.x86.dll not found: The required DLL file is absent from the expected directory. This can result from software uninstalls, updates, or system changes that mistakenly remove or relocate DLL files.
  • The file XCShellMenu.x86.dll is missing: The specified DLL file couldn't be found. It may have been unintentionally deleted or moved from its original location.
  • XCShellMenu.x86.dll could not be loaded: This error indicates that the DLL file, necessary for certain operations, couldn't be loaded by the system. Potential causes might include missing DLL files, DLL files that are not properly registered in the system, or conflicts with other software.

Step 1: Create a Windows 10 Installation Media

Step 1: Create a Windows 10 Installation Media Thumbnail
  1. Go to the Microsoft website and download the Windows 10 Media Creation Tool.

  2. Run the tool and select Create installation media for another PC.

  3. Follow the prompts to create a bootable USB drive or ISO file.

Step 2: Start the Repair Install

Step 2: Start the Repair Install Thumbnail
  1. Insert the Windows 10 installation media you created into your PC and run setup.exe.

  2. Follow the prompts until you get to the Ready to install screen.

Step 3: Choose the Right Install Option

Step 3: Choose the Right Install Option Thumbnail
  1. On the Ready to install screen, make sure Keep personal files and apps is selected.

  2. Click Install to start the repair install.

Step 4: Complete the Installation

Step 4: Complete the Installation Thumbnail
  1. Your computer will restart several times during the installation. Make sure not to turn off your computer during this process.

Step 5: Check if the Problem is Solved

Step 5: Check if the Problem is Solved Thumbnail
  1. After the installation, check if the XCShellMenu.x86.dll problem persists.
